Transaction 8585277884e881099ebf725ec08dd4ffb5dffbab70e439d641b027ce2257ca5d

2 Input
2 Outputs
  • 8585277884e881099ebf725ec08dd4ffb5dffbab70e439d641b027ce2257ca5d:0
  • value  7475615
    address  186PmuAjwXAuEihD9NKZbrwUDJPRirroP1
  • 8585277884e881099ebf725ec08dd4ffb5dffbab70e439d641b027ce2257ca5d:1
  • value  18464
    address  3NFX4Dz9XfjJA2GzTQryr5JhtMXZNqdWC5